Transaction d9f8190e4ff3ae19703d205f0507942e4742f3a2cc6105a34480da06c908f903

7 Input
1 Outputs
  • d9f8190e4ff3ae19703d205f0507942e4742f3a2cc6105a34480da06c908f903:0
  • value  2927946
    address  1GEjS9EEbvZu1xzeY1hsK2EtpCRXUbq5EB